Audiences are invited to laugh, cry and celebrate the miracle of life with “Baby,” opening Saturday and playing through Nov. 16 at The Olive Branch, inside the Valencia Town Center.
“This touching and spirited musical production captures the joy, fear and wonder of impending parenthood through the stories of three very different couples — all experiencing one of life’s most universal adventures,” said a news release from the nonprofit Olive Branch Theatricals.
Directed by Diana Rizzo and choreographed by Annette Sintia Duran, “Baby” follows college sweethearts, 30-something professionals and a couple well into middle age, all on the rollercoaster ride of becoming parents.
